Water Inlet Valve for Washer/Dryer Combo.
This valve is compatible with several brands, including GE, Hotpoint, RCA, and Kenmore/Sears. It serves as an original equipment manufacturer (OEM) replacement part specifically designed for GE washing machines. You'll find this component at the rear of the washer where it connects to the water supply hoses. Its primary function is to control the entry of water into the washing machine. When the machine is set to begin a cycle, the control board or timer triggers the valve, allowing it to open and water to flow into the tub. The valve is crucial for maintaining the appropriate water level during each washing cycle, ensuring efficient operation.
The valve addresses various issues such as:
- Absence of water during the wash cycle's initial fill stage.
- Low water levels in the tub, which can hinder effective washing or rinsing.
- Continuous or excessive water flow leading to overflow or potential leaks.
